未处理SqlException用户用户sa登录失败18456的原因

sqlserver2005 一般都是可以用sa登陆的但是,sql server 2088 sa昰不可用的如果手动配置保存的时候,sqlserver弹出错误提示“无法设置主体sa的凭据”所以,要自己建立一个用户赋予和sa一样的权限。

 MSSQLServer无法啟动是因为,我把它的网络禁用了所以,打开网络之后就可以使用了关闭,打开网络的方法是:

}

sql server2016这个高版本居然在SSMS界面上没有顯示,但可以从错误日志中看到

  ‘帐户当前被锁定,所以用户 'sa' 用户sa登录失败18456。系统管理员无法将该帐户解锁’解决方法
  如果短时間内不停连接就会被SQL SERVER误认为是这是攻击,sql server引用了windows的密码策略方案一般默认超过3次错误登录就会将此账号锁定。
  要用windows身份验证登录 戓者用其他管理员账户登录上去修改;

  (1)2005及以上版本把sa的强制密码策略去掉就可以了。不然他会引用widows密码策略

  (2)如果SA密碼三次敲错 会被锁定 ,这是windows密码策略的默认情况

  (3)修改windows密码策略: 在操作系统的-》控制面板-》管理工具-》本地安全策略-》賬户策略-》账户锁定策略-》将 帐户锁定阈值 修改为 0 即可

用其他windows管理员账户  或  其他SQL 管理员账户把这个强制实施密码策略关掉即可

【SSMS图形界面解决】

用其他windows管理员账户  或  其他SQL 管理员账户,把这个强制实施密码策略关掉即可

}

简介:解决办法:使用sa进入新建查询,

执行查询语句再次登录成功

}

我要回帖

更多关于 用户sa登录失败18456 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信